Audible Studios, a production arm of Audible.com, today
announced the release of On Power, by acclaimed bestselling author
Robert Caro. In the audio-only project, adapted from two of the
legendary historian’s recent speeches, Caro discusses what drew him
to investigate political power as a young journalist, and what his
fifty years of writing about political power has taught him about
its uses and abuses in American democracy. He also reminisces about
the moment when he first realized that in order to write about
power truthfully, it would be necessary to write about those
without power. Narrated with emotion and humor by Caro, On Power is
now available for download exclusively from Audible at
www.audible.com/caro.
“My books are an attempt to examine and explain political power:
how it is created, how it works, how it can be used – for good and
for ill,” said Caro. “I thought it was important to try to do that
because that power shapes all our lives – in large ways and small.
And I felt that the more America understands political power, the
better informed our voters will be, and then, hopefully the better
our democracy will be.”

Robert A. Caro is the winner of two Pulitzer Prizes in
Biography; two National Book Awards, three National Book Critics
Circle Awards, for Best Nonfiction Book of the Year and Best
Biography; and many other awards. His first book, The Power Broker,
was chosen by the Modern Library as one of the hundred greatest
nonfiction books of the twentieth century and by Time magazine as
one of the hundred top nonfiction books of all time.
